MU welcomes Margarethe Rammerstorfer, head of the new Department of International Management
February 13, 2014
MU is pleased to announce that Margarethe Rammerstorfer has joined the full time faculty. In addition to teaching in the BBA and BSc programs, she is head of the new Department of International Management and will also fulfill the role as a Program Area Director for International Management.
Before coming to MU, she was Assistant professor at the Finance, Accounting and Statistics department at the Vienna University of Business and Economics (WU), where she earned her doctorate degree in 2007. On the topic of ‘’Energy Markets and Investments’’ she recently finished her habilitation, the highest academic qualification a scholar can achieve by his or her own pursuit in many European and Central Asian countries.
Her research interests include regulatory and competition economics, energy economics, real options, dynamic optimization, applied econometrics, and investments in regulated networks. Her newest research interest covers the combination between social impact investment return.
